Months after his son's death, Engineer commits suicide in Jammu
The story is about the mass corruption in PHE Department of Jammu and Kashmir which claimed the life of an Executive Engineer and his engineer son within a year. Both the father-son duo committed suicide within a gap of few months.

RAMESH KUMAR Gupta was posted by PHE Minister, Taj Mohi-u-Din as Executive Engineer at Baghliar project to discount the trauma, after he lost his son. It had not been long since the person had been promoted but, Gupta jumped from the fifth floor of Government Medical College, Jammu yesterday, without any reported immediate provocation.


As per the reports, he parked his car at the Government Medical College, Jammu and then rushed to the fifth floor of the college building from where he jumped and died on the spot. Reports also said that police have recovered a suicide note from the spot, in which Gupta has not blamed any person for this extreme step.


The deceased, Ramesh Kumar Gupta was a son of Bajender Gupta resident of Channi, Jammu. It is worthwhile to mention here that the son of the deceased too had committed suicide almost a year ago by jumping into the River Chenab when he too was posted there as Junior Engineer.
